WOODSTOCK - It's an event that Woodstock residents of all ages look forward to each year.
Today is opening day for the 187th Woodstock Fair and a lot of your favourites will be returning this year including Old McDonald's Barn, the Youth Scavenger Hunt, and the Campbell Amusements midway.
Today also happens to be Toonie Day for the midway. This means ride coupons will only cost $2 each and you'll only need one or two coupons to go an a ride. You can find the daily operating hours for the midway, as well as the price of ride coupons and bracelets online here.
Touch a Truck will be taking place on Friday as well as the Big Shiny Tunes night, with live music and a 19-plus beverage garden.
It's a busy schedule on the Saturday with the Horse Show, the Raptor Show (featuring birds of prey), the Chainsaw Carving Show, and the Stock Tractor Pull.
Sunday's schedule includes the Pet Show, the Pet Talent Show, and the Impact Sports Demolition Derby.
Admission is free to get into the fair, but you will have to pay $5 if you want to watch the tractor pull or the demo derby.
